Embracing Mindfulness: A Path to Inner Harmony

“Mindfulness is the key to unlocking the fullness of life.” – Jon Kabat-Zinn

In a world filled with distractions and constant stimuli, mindfulness serves as a lifeline to reconnect with our inner selves. This collection of mindfulness quotes is curated to remind you of the beauty of living in the present moment. As Jon Kabat-Zinn eloquently puts it, mindfulness allows us to embrace life in its entirety, enabling us to savor each experience and find joy in the simplest of moments.

Nurturing Self-Awareness with Wisdom

“The way to live in the present is to remember that ‘This too shall pass.'” – Eckhart Tolle

Eckhart Tolle’s words encapsulate the essence of mindfulness – the understanding that everything is temporary. Our compilation of quotes delves deep into this wisdom, emphasizing the significance of self-awareness. By acknowledging the impermanence of circumstances, we can free ourselves from unnecessary worries and focus on what truly matters.

Overcoming Challenges with Resilience

“You can’t stop the waves, but you can learn to surf.” – Jon Kabat-Zinn

Life’s challenges are inevitable, but our response to them defines our journey. This collection showcases quotes that highlight the resilience mindfulness cultivates within us. Jon Kabat-Zinn’s metaphor of surfing the waves beautifully illustrates the concept of adapting and thriving in the face of adversity.

Mindfulness in Relationships: Nurturing Connections

“When you love someone, the best thing you can offer is your presence.” – Thich Nhat Hanh

Mindfulness extends beyond personal growth; it enriches our relationships as well. Thich Nhat Hanh’s quote underscores the importance of being fully present with loved ones. Our quotes delve into the ways mindfulness can deepen connections, foster empathy, and promote open communication.
